What is the value of english links with foreign language anchor text for a foreign site?
-
I have a site in Spanish that is hosted in Spain with a .es TLD.
I already have many Spanish-language links from websites in Spain, but I obviously want more and I'm finding I might need to look beyond typical Spanish sites.
In talking to some of my link builders who work on my English/American sites, they are recommending that I build links on the normal article sites, blogs and web 2.0 sites that I normally build links on but that I make all the content English and insert the anchor text in Spanish.
For example, if my site were about "weightloss", my keyword would be "perder peso" (in spanish). They are recommending that I have articles, reviews, etc written about weightloss in English with the anchor text "perder peso" worked into the English article. Most of the sites are English sites that are hosted in the US (article sites, web 2.0 properties, etc).
My question is what is the value of these links? Does anybody have any experience with this?

Hi Jason!
Alex has a good point there, spanish anchor text inside english text will just look spammy.
One thing to remember is that Google recognize synonyms and other languages as well. If you want to build links for the spanish word "perder peso" and find it very tough to make it effective, links from english sites with the english anchor text "weight loss" will help you as well (the effect might not be as good as with spanish, but it will help).
Google will understand that "perder peso" equals "weight loss". But the recommendation is to work with links for the goal language, it´s most relevant for the users and in the eyes of Google.

It'll just look spammy. Exact matching anchor text seems to be becoming less effective anyway, and Google is good at looking at the context links are placed in, so if a Spanish link is inserted into otherwise English text that will probably look dodgy. And if you're targeting Spanish search engines, links from other countries have less value anyway.
